- [ ] Step 7: Archive cold storage buckets (Glacierline tier). Confirm both ceremony witnesses are present, verify bucket manifests match the Oxbow ledger, then seal the archive key shares. Plugin authors may observe but not handle shares. Once sealed, the archive index itself is encrypted and can only be reopened with the passphrase below.

vault phrase of badup-hahig = tamael-aldael-kelmir-istael-fenok-istwyn-tamius-jorath-oliion

## 2.9.0 — Calendar sync defaults changed

Heads up: Plinth now resolves calendar sync conflicts with last-writer-wins instead of prompting. Too many stuck syncs were paging folks at 3am over duplicate Meetwell events. Conflicted entries land in the quarantine table for 72 hours, so nothing's lost. If you get paged anyway, check the values below first.

config for kafof-bawef:
holath:
  log_level: debug
  metrics_host: metrics.holath.qorvelsys.internal
  pin: 2191
  pool_size: 32

The Orvane Labs bike cage and the east and west parking gates operate on separate access schedules, and facilities desk staff should note that visitor vehicles may only use the west gate between 07:00 and 19:00. Cyclists requesting cage access must show a valid day pass, and their details should be entered in the access ledger before the cage is opened. Gates must never be propped open, even briefly, during deliveries. When a manual override is required at either gate, use the code below.

staff pass of fadup-fawig = bdg-FUNKS-4

**Heads-up: the mail room has moved!**

As of this week, the Quillford mail room lives on the ground floor of the Barrow Street annexe, just past the goods lift — not in the basement anymore. Night shift: overnight courier drops now go straight to the annexe hatch, so don't leave parcels at the old basement door; nobody checks it. The sorting shelves are labelled by team, same as before. To get into the annexe after hours, punch in the door code below.

badge for hahif-faweg: bdg-VF-9